Daniel Benefiel knows the power of networking. He came to staffing while he was waiting tables just after finishing his degree in business administration and management at Indiana University. “A buddy of mine I’d worked with in the restaurant industry had landed himself [in staffing. He] called and said, ‘Hey, we’ve got a position for a recruiter who speaks Spanish.’ I spoke it really well at the time,” Benefiel says. “And the rest is history.”

In a similar vein, former colleagues and a former supervisor eventually enticed him to the Morales Group, where he has been for nearly 10 years and currently serves as VP of staffing operations.

The Morales Group is an Indianapolis-based firm that focuses on serving underserved communities such as refugees and immigrants by connecting them to upwardly mobile careers as well as to resources like English classes, continuing education and basic needs support. In 2020 and 2021, Benefiel led the company’s efforts to flip its recruitment process to be accessible 100% online. This not only helped the company weather the effects of the pandemic, but it also created transportation equity for candidates who no longer needed to transport themselves in person to apply for job openings.

Benefiel says that of all his recent accomplishments, he’s most proud of guiding four Hispanic colleagues — three of whom are women — into leadership positions.
